Home
last modified time | relevance | path

Searched refs:aTangent (Results 1 – 3 of 3) sorted by relevance

/core/svgio/source/svgreader/
H A Dsvgtextpathnode.cxx167 basegfx::B2DVector aTangent(0.0, 1.0); in allowChange() local
172 aTangent = maCurrentSegment.getTangent(0.0); in allowChange()
173 aTangent.normalize(); in allowChange()
174 … aPosition = maCurrentSegment.getStartPoint() + (aTangent * (mfPosition - mfSegmentStartPosition)); in allowChange()
179 aTangent = maCurrentSegment.getTangent(1.0); in allowChange()
180 aTangent.normalize(); in allowChange()
181 … aPosition = maCurrentSegment.getEndPoint() + (aTangent * (mfPosition - mfSegmentStartPosition)); in allowChange()
201 aTangent = maCurrentSegment.getTangent(fBezierDistance); in allowChange()
202 aTangent.normalize(); in allowChange()
216 aPosition -= fHalfSnippetWidth * aTangent; in allowChange()
[all …]
/core/basegfx/source/polygon/
H A Db2dlinegeometry.cxx573 B2DVector aTangent(rEdge.getEndPoint() - rEdge.getStartPoint()); in createAreaGeometryForEdge() local
574 aTangent.setLength(fHalfLineWidth); in createAreaGeometryForEdge()
591 fAngle = atan2(aTangent.getY(), aTangent.getX()); in createAreaGeometryForEdge()
602 aPerpend.setX(-aTangent.getY()); in createAreaGeometryForEdge()
603 aPerpend.setY(aTangent.getX()); in createAreaGeometryForEdge()
608 const basegfx::B2DPoint aStart(rEdge.getStartPoint() - aTangent); in createAreaGeometryForEdge()
628 fAngle = atan2(aTangent.getY(), aTangent.getX()); in createAreaGeometryForEdge()
643 aPerpend.setX(-aTangent.getY()); in createAreaGeometryForEdge()
644 aPerpend.setY(aTangent.getX()); in createAreaGeometryForEdge()
649 const basegfx::B2DPoint aEnd(rEdge.getEndPoint() + aTangent); in createAreaGeometryForEdge()
/core/basegfx/source/curve/
H A Db2dcubicbezier.cxx540 if(!aTangent.equalZero()) in getTangent()
542 return aTangent; in getTangent()
547 aTangent = (getControlPointB() - getStartPoint()) * 0.3; in getTangent()
549 if(!aTangent.equalZero()) in getTangent()
551 return aTangent; in getTangent()
560 B2DVector aTangent(getEndPoint() - getControlPointB()); in getTangent() local
562 if(!aTangent.equalZero()) in getTangent()
564 return aTangent; in getTangent()
569 aTangent = (getEndPoint() - getControlPointA()) * 0.3; in getTangent()
571 if(!aTangent.equalZero()) in getTangent()
[all …]